高级软件工程师教会小白的那些事(16)

我发现有一点很奇怪,那就是我的自然倾向和本能反应竟然与最佳解决方案大相径庭。

我认为这种本能也让我走上了解决bug的漫长道路。有时,我觉得它不work,就是因为我写的代码出了问题,而且我会深入研究我写的每一行代码。像深度优先搜索那样。

最后发现是配置更改导致时,也就是说,我没有事先启用该功能,这让我很生气。我在改bug方面做得远远达不到最优。

从那时起,我的启发式方法就是在深度优先搜索之前进行广度优先搜索,以摆脱顶级节点。我可以使用当前资源确认什么?

机器开启了吗?

是否装好了正确的代码?

配置到位了吗?

,就像代码中的路由是否正确?

架构版本是否正确?

然后,进入代码部分。

我们以为是nginx没有在机器上正确安装好,但最后发现,只是配置被设置了false。

推荐阅读